Hi i am self employed but i only work part time. As this suit looking after the kids with my partner who works part time she employed though. My question is i have been self employed for 3 yrs and i havent earned enough to pay any tax.This also suits me! I want to know would this ever be a problem with the tax man because i only need part time money so intent to keep working part time only. thanks john

As long as you have been completing Tax Returns to declare your Self Employment profits each year and you have kept records to back those up there should not be any problems.
The only thing I can think of is that you may not be paying a National Insurance contribution and might want to look into your future State Pension entitlement at some point.I am an Accountant.
